mirror of
https://github.com/OPM/ResInsight.git
synced 2025-02-25 18:55:39 -06:00
(#401) WIP: Refactoring Linked views update system.
Preparing for linking of visible Cells.
This commit is contained in:
@@ -217,6 +217,7 @@ void RimViewLink::fieldChangedByUi(const caf::PdmFieldHandle* changedField, cons
|
||||
else if (&syncVisibleCells == changedField)
|
||||
{
|
||||
updateOptionSensitivity();
|
||||
configureOverridesUpdateDisplayModel();
|
||||
}
|
||||
}
|
||||
|
||||
@@ -258,7 +259,7 @@ void RimViewLink::configureOverridesUpdateDisplayModel()
|
||||
configureOverrides();
|
||||
|
||||
// This update scheduling actually schedules update in the master view (not the managed view). Is that intentional ? JJS
|
||||
|
||||
/*
|
||||
if (m_managedView)
|
||||
{
|
||||
m_managedView->rangeFilterCollection()->updateDisplayModeNotifyManagedViews();
|
||||
@@ -275,7 +276,7 @@ void RimViewLink::configureOverridesUpdateDisplayModel()
|
||||
{
|
||||
geoView->propertyFilterCollection()->updateDisplayModelNotifyManagedViews();
|
||||
}
|
||||
|
||||
*/
|
||||
// Todo : Notify the managed view of the possible change of visualCellsOverride
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user